topshape sol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square solid-square

            以太坊钱包智能合约的真假判别与防范指南

            • 2026-02-01 00:46:04

                      引言

                      随着区块链技术的发展,以太坊作为一种去中心化的智能合约平台,受到了广泛的关注。以太坊的智能合约让开发者能够在区块链上编写复杂的协议,涉及到从金融服务到供应链管理等多个领域。然而,正因为其开放性和去中心化的特性,骗局和不安全的智能合约也屡见不鲜。为了保护用户的资产安全,了解如何判别以太坊钱包中的智能合约的真假变得尤为重要。

                      以太坊钱包及其功能

                      以太坊钱包是用来存储、管理以太币(ETH)和基于以太坊的代币(如ERC20代币)的工具。它们可以是软件钱包、硬件钱包或纸钱包。其中,软件钱包又分为热钱包和冷钱包。热钱包是连网的钱包,更加方便但安全性略低;冷钱包则是离线的钱包,安全性较高但使用不够便捷。

                      以太坊钱包的主要功能包括:发送和接收以太币、查看交易记录、与智能合约交互等。用户可以通过与不同的DApp(去中心化应用)交互,使用智能合约来完成各种操作,然而,这也为骗局提供了可乘之机。

                      智能合约的工作原理

                      智能合约是一种自动执行的程序,规定了一系列条件和规则。一旦条件被满足,合约就会自动执行,无需中介。这种自我执行的机制使得智能合约在金融交易中被广泛使用,比如ICO(首次代币发行)、去中心化交易所(DEX)等。

                      然而,智能合约的代码是由人编写的,可能会存在bug或恶意代码。一些诈骗者可能会创建带有漏洞或恶意代码的智能合约,通过诱骗用户投入资金而获利,从而造成用户的财产损失。

                      判别以太坊钱包智能合约的真假

                      判断智能合约的真假,首先要关注其代码。这要求用户具有一定的技术知识,但即使没有专业背景,用户也能通过一些方式进行初步判断。

                      1. **代码审计**:一些知名的智能合约项目会进行公开代码审计,用户可以查询这些报告,查看合约是否有安全漏洞。如未经过审计的合约建议谨慎使用。

                      2. **开源代码**:优质的智能合约通常会开放其代码供公众审查。这不仅能够增加透明度,还能便于社区的技术爱好者进行审核,及时发现潜在问题。

                      3. **社区反馈**:查阅相关的社区反馈和评论,可以了解其他用户对该智能合约的看法。如果多名用户表示存在问题或不信任,那么该智能合约可能存在风险。

                      4. **开发者背景**:审查合约开发者的背景和声誉也是判断智能合约安全性的重要因素。知名的大型项目团队通常会有相对的信誉保障。

                      5. **限额与锁仓机制**:如果合约设计了资金锁仓和限额功能,能够有效降低暴走事件的发生几率。这类合约通常更可靠。

                      如何防范以太坊智能合约骗局

                      1. **保持警惕**:时刻保持警惕,不轻信高收益邀请,尤其是对新项目的盲目信任。

                      2. **使用知名平台**:尽量使用主流且知名的钱包和交易平台,避免使用来路不明的工具及网站。

                      3. **学习基本知识**:了解以太坊智能合约的工作原理,学习一些基本的安全知识和工具,增强防范意识。

                      4. **多重验证**:在进行大额交易前,尽量通过多种渠道(三方验证、社区反馈等)确认合约的可靠性。

                      5. **定期更新**:对钱包应用保持定期更新,确保使用的是最新的安全版本,及时修复潜在的漏洞。

                      常见问题解答

                      1. 为什么以太坊智能合约会存在安全风险?

                      以太坊智能合约是基于代码运行的,任何编写的代码都有可能出现bug。即使是经验丰富的开发者也可能在复杂的逻辑中犯错。此外,恶意开发者也可能故意设计带有漏洞的合约,诱骗用户进行投资或存款,这导致了智能合约的安全风险。

                      2. 如何评估合约的审计报告?

                      审计报告是评估智能合约安全性的重要工具。在阅读审计报告时,关键是关注以下几点:审计机构的信誉、报告中指出的任何漏洞和解决方案、以及合约接受审计的历史记录。如果审计机构不少于三家,且通过调研发现它们信誉颇高,则相对而言该合约的安全可能性更高。

                      3. 什么是“锁仓机制”,它如何增加安全性?

                      锁仓机制是智能合约的一种设计,通过将资金锁定在合约中,直到满足某种条件为止,防止开发者或其他参与者随意取出资金。这样的设计可以保护投资者的资金,减少项目方逃跑的风险。

                      4. 是否可以借助工具来检查合约的安全性?

                      是的,市场上有许多工具和平台可以用来检查智能合约的安全性,如MythX、Slither等。它们可以帮助用户识别代码中的逻辑错误和潜在安全风险。然而,这些工具并不能完全替代人工审计,因此建议用户在使用之前应结合其他验证方式。

                      5. 有哪些案例说明智能合约的风险?

                      过去发生过多个因为智能合约漏洞导致资金损失的案例,最著名的之一是“DAO事件”。在2016年,一个名为DAO的投资基金因其智能合约的漏洞,遭黑客攻击,导致一半资金被盗。此外,其他EIP创新也因升级导致合约中出现未知bug,而造成用户资产损失。这些事件提醒用户在与智能合约交互时需格外谨慎。

                      总结

                      以太坊钱包和智能合约的使用可以为我们带来极大的便利,但也伴随着安全风险。在使用这些技术时,增强风险意识以及具备基本的安全知识是非常必要的。希望通过这篇文章,能够帮助读者更好地理解如何判别智能合约的真假,提高安全防范能力。

                      • Tags
                      • 以太坊钱包,智能合约,真假判别,安全防范